summaryrefslogtreecommitdiff
path: root/archaeological_finds
diff options
context:
space:
mode:
authorÉtienne Loks <etienne.loks@iggdrasil.net>2017-08-29 10:06:01 +0200
committerÉtienne Loks <etienne.loks@iggdrasil.net>2017-08-29 10:06:01 +0200
commit44f79d80f9cc06ddc3c42fd987ed2019ed7abe8b (patch)
tree877babb2ddf9bfdf644490e0cad348027dc8fdba /archaeological_finds
parenta8fc3cc68ee42308da05d017e3b59c059dd58ca0 (diff)
downloadIshtar-44f79d80f9cc06ddc3c42fd987ed2019ed7abe8b.tar.bz2
Ishtar-44f79d80f9cc06ddc3c42fd987ed2019ed7abe8b.zip
Change image path for finds (do not repeat operation index)
Diffstat (limited to 'archaeological_finds')
-rw-r--r--archaeological_finds/models_finds.py6
1 files changed, 3 insertions, 3 deletions
diff --git a/archaeological_finds/models_finds.py b/archaeological_finds/models_finds.py
index 71b57849e..6154fb74d 100644
--- a/archaeological_finds/models_finds.py
+++ b/archaeological_finds/models_finds.py
@@ -25,7 +25,6 @@ from django.core.urlresolvers import reverse
from django.db import connection, transaction
from django.db.models import Max, Q
from django.db.models.signals import m2m_changed, post_save, post_delete
-from django.utils.text import slugify
from django.utils.translation import ugettext_lazy as _, ugettext
from ishtar_common.data_importer import post_importer_action, ImporterError
@@ -784,8 +783,9 @@ class Find(BulkUpdatedItem, ValueGetter, BaseHistorizedItem, ImageModel,
if not bf:
return u"detached/{}".format(self.SLUG)
ope = bf.context_record.operation
- return u"operation/{}/{}/{}/{}".format(
- ope.year, ope.reference, self.SLUG, slugify(self.reference))
+ find_idx = u'{:0' + str(settings.ISHTAR_FINDS_INDEX_ZERO_LEN) + 'd}'
+ return (u"operation/{}/{}/{}/" + find_idx).format(
+ ope.year, ope.reference, self.SLUG, self.index)
@property
def administrative_index(self):